SEO基础

SEO基础

Products

当前位置:首页 > SEO基础 >

如何在Linux文件中高效搜索含通配符的关键词?

96SEO 2025-11-06 02:02 0


在Linux系统中,文件搜索是一个常见且关键的任务。有效的文件搜索能搞优良干活效率,少许些不少许不了的时候浪费。本文将详细介绍怎么在Linux文件中高大效搜索含通配符的关键词,帮您飞迅速定位所需文件呃。

grep命令:文本搜索的利器

grep命令是Linux中最常用的文本搜索工具之一。它能在文件中搜索指定的字符串或模式。用grep命令搜索含通配符的关键词,能通过以下步骤实现:

Linux 如何在文件内容中搜索带有通配符的关键字
  1. 打开终端。
  2. 输入grep命令,后面跟上要搜索的内容和文件名。
  3. 用通配符来指定搜索模式。

比方说 搜索文件中包含"foo"的关键词,能用以下命令: bash grep "foo*" filename.txt 这里"foo"代表以"foo"开头,后面跟任意个字符的字符串。

find命令:按文件名搜索

find命令是Linux中用于查找文件的有力巨大工具。它能根据文件名、文件类型、文件巨大细小等条件进行搜索。

  1. 打开终端。
  2. 输入find命令,后面跟上搜索路径、文件名和通配符。
  3. 用通配符来指定搜索模式。

比方说 搜索当前目录及其子目录中以"login.py"的文件,能用以下命令: bash find . -name "login.py" 这里"."代表当前目录,"-name"代表按照文件名进行搜索,"login.py"代表以"login.py"的文件。

locate命令:飞迅速定位文件

locate命令是一种基于文件名的飞迅速文件定位工具。它能在系统范围内飞迅速查找文件。

  1. 打开终端。
  2. 输入locate命令,后面跟上要搜索的内容和通配符。
  3. 用通配符来指定搜索模式。

技巧与

  1. 用grep、find和locate命令能高大效地搜索含通配符的关键词
  2. 在用通配符时注意不要将*放在字符串中间,否则会被默觉得字符串。
  3. 能结合优良几个通配符一起用,以创建更麻烦的搜索模式。
  4. 熟练掌握这些个命令,能巨大巨大搞优良Linux文件搜索效率。

通过本文的介绍,相信您已经掌握了在Linux文件中高大效搜索含通配符的关键词的方法。在实际操作中,根据需要灵活运用这些个命令,相信您会受益匪浅薄。


标签: 通配符

提交需求或反馈

Demand feedback